I also think that support for an array of functions is needed to cover 
all scenarios and cleanup the code a little bit. The real problem with 
tcases is that sometimes we are doing what we might do with multiple 
functions, but using an approach which is expecting struct and some sort 
of "filtering" in .test_all function.

And in some cases, where one particular testcase differs by a statement 
from an another, struct needs a flag to filter out the specific 
testcase. This would be easy to handle with two different functions.

Also the output message sometimes is stored into the struct, in order to 
show the correct TPASS/TFAIL message we need, according with the tcase. 
And this is probably an overengineering solution, since that would be 
handled well using multiple testcases functions, testing different 
scenarios and using different output messages.

Also simple tests, such as input arguments unit tests, would benefit 
from array of tests functions, since we can split tcases into multiple 
functions and make code more readable.

To sum up things, I think that having support for an array of test 
functions can cleanup code in many tests and make them easier to 
read/maintain. tcases can still do well sometimes, but adding the 
support for an array of functions can improve the LTP framework and so 
the way we are testing the kernel.
